These two events are ... WebSep 5, 2016 · In Auslan, to talk about the days of the week and the months of the year, we fingerspell abbreviations for the words. While most of them are obvious, there are still correct and incorrect ways to spell them. For example, we spell FR for Friday, not FRI. Sunday has its own sign, and Thursday, strangely, can be signed with the middle finger ...
